The problem of astigmatism can be tough to grasp. It is a refractive mistake that can be present from birth or establish during childhood or after eye injuries or surgery.

The cornea and lens work to refocus light getting in the eyes into a solitary prime focus on the retina. With astigmatism, light gets in the eye in two different locations as well as generates blurred or distorted photos.

Reasons


Astigmatism is a refractive error, which suggests that light entering the eye doesn't concentrate precisely on the back of the eye (the retina). The result is fuzzy vision.

Normally, the cornea and lens refract light precisely so that light signals are focused on the retina to create clear, crisp images in the mind. But with astigmatism, the cornea or lens aren't flawlessly bent. Instead, they are much more like a ball or an American football with steeper as well as flatter sides.

Medical diagnosis


During a full eye examination, an eye doctor or eye doctor can discover astigmatism. They use special tools to determine your capacity to see things plainly at different ranges as well as focus light properly on the retina.

Typically, light going into the eye travels through the lens as well as cornea to assemble at one prime focus on the retina. But with astigmatism, the form of the cornea or lens is irregular, so light doesn't merge at a single spot on the retina, developing blurred and also altered vision.

One of the most common methods for discovering astigmatism are the visual acuity examination as well as refraction examinations. Your doctor may also make use of a device called a keratometer to get a measurement of the cornea's shape, or use a Jackson cross cyndrical tube to subjectively refine those measurements. Treatment


An individual with astigmatism has an irregular curve in the front surface of the eye. This influences just how light rays concentrate on the retina, producing fuzzy vision. Glasses and also contact lenses remedy this by placing a lens with the right prescription in front of the eyes.

Your optometrist can identify astigmatism throughout an extensive eye exam. They may make use of a phoropter (an instrument with dials to check refractive error) as well as a Snellen Graph to analyze your visual acuity. They can likewise use an autorefractor to shine light into your eye as well as examine exactly how the return picture focuses on your retina.
